Sorry I didn't spot your question earlier.

The rain in the fall typically is what dictates how the spring flowers look. That was documented as the case by researchers out in the desert southwest, and I think we can look at last fall's drought and conclude that it makes a difference here also. The flowers weren't out in any way like they usually are.
